This is a slanted sans with sturdy, low-contrast strokes and smoothly rounded curves. Letterforms lean consistently forward with a lively rhythm, combining open apertures and compact counters that keep the texture dense and bold on the page. Terminals are generally clean and slightly softened rather than sharp, and curves (notably in C, G, O, and S) read as elliptical and well controlled. Numerals match the assertive weight and forward angle, with simple, legible shapes that align comfortably with the caps.

It performs best where strong emphasis and momentum are desired, such as headlines, posters, sports-related graphics, and brand marks. The dense, bold texture also suits short-to-medium bursts of copy in packaging or promotional layouts, especially when a modern, dynamic voice is needed.

The overall tone is energetic and contemporary, with a confident, go-forward feel driven by the consistent slant and strong weight. It suggests motion and emphasis without becoming decorative, making it feel sporty and headline-ready while still staying clean.

The design appears intended to deliver a modern, high-impact italic sans that reads quickly and projects motion. Its rounded construction and uniform stroke treatment aim for clarity and consistency while maintaining a bold, attention-grabbing presence.

Capitals are relatively wide and stable, while lowercase forms maintain a compact, purposeful footprint; the resulting line texture is bold and continuous in running text. The italic construction appears integral to the design rather than a simple mechanical slant, giving curves and joins a more intentional, streamlined flow.
